️ What It Is
A counter-service dining spot themed as a former RDA mess hall now serving wholesome, flavorful meals inspired by Pandora’s natural bounty. It’s known for build-your-own bowls, steamed pods (like bao buns with fillings), desserts, and unique beverages. 
⸻
⭐ Overall Impressions
What People Love
Unique & high-quality food
• Fans say the bowls are refreshing and flavorful, a nice change from typical theme-park burgers and fries. 
• The menu appeals to adults and kids alike — from cheeseburger steamed pods and hearty protein bowls to lighter salad bases. 
• Many visitors consider it one of the best quick-service spots in all of Walt Disney World with a very high positive rating from guests. 
Great theming & atmosphere
• The immersive Pandora environment is a hit — indoor seating is air-conditioned (a plus in Florida heat), with outdoor patio views of lush surroundings. 
Fast service & good logistics
• Mobile ordering is available and recommended during peak meal times to reduce waits. 
⸻
Things to Know
Can get crowded
• Lunch and dinner times often bring long lines and limited seating early in the day if you don’t arrive early or use Mobile Order. 
Not ideal for picky eaters
• The menu leans toward bowls, sauces, and creative items — so super simple palate preferences might be harder to satisfy. 
Mixed opinions exist
• Most reviews are excellent, but a few report occasional inconsistency in protein texture or seasoning. 
⸻
Menu Highlights
• Customizable bowls: bases like rice, salad, or potato hash with protein choices (chicken, beef, shrimp, tofu) + sauces. 
• Cheeseburger Steamed Pods: fun, hearty bao-style bites. 
• Kid-friendly options: hot dogs wrapped in dough, quesadillas, fruit and sides. 
• Desserts: Blueberry Cream Cheese Mousse and other sweet options. 
• Breakfast (seasonal): options like cinnamon French toast and fruit bowls, offering a nice early-park meal choice. 
Price & Value
Moderate pricing (typically around ~$13–$19 for adult meals), often considered good value for quality in-park quick service.
